IYO SKY Triumphs Over Rhea Ripley to Capture WWE Women's World Championship

Unbelievably, on March 3, 2025, episode of WWE Monday Night Raw, IYO SKY defeated Rhea Ripley to claim the WWE Women's World Championship in the main event. The victory is not only a milestone in the life of SKY, but it creates huge ripples in the situation of the women's division of WWE.

The Journey to the Championship Match

The lead-up to this match was just as exciting as the match itself. At the Elimination Chamber event, held in Houston on March 1, 2025, Bianca Belair had the last word and stomped away, earning a shot at the Women's World Championship title at WrestleMania. Thus, it was all set that the winner between SKY and Ripley would go on to face Belair, perhaps the most important contest in all wrestling. The fact that Belair had chosen to "watch from ringside" during the high-stakes showdown added another twist.
